Product Description

The CHICAGO-LATROBE 46714 is a cobalt jobber length drill bit designed for high-performance drilling in hard and abrasive materials. Sized to wire gauge No. 44 (0.0860 inches decimal), this bit features a 135-degree split point that reduces walking and requires no center punch on most surfaces. The gold oxide coating improves lubricity and heat resistance during cutting. Built to Series 550 standards and conforming to DIN 338 and NAS 907 Type J specifications, this is a heavy-duty tool suited for production and maintenance drilling applications. It is installed and used by machinists, HVAC technicians, plumbers, electricians, and other trades requiring precision small-diameter drilling in tough base materials.

The 46714 is engineered for drilling titanium and other high-strength metals where standard high-speed steel bits fall short. The M42 cobalt alloy construction handles elevated cutting temperatures without losing hardness. With a 2-1/8-inch overall length and 1-1/8-inch flute length, this bit is suited for typical jobber-depth holes in sheet stock, structural members, and mechanical assemblies. The straight cylindrical shank fits standard drill chucks across corded and cordless platforms. Right-hand spiral flute geometry clears chips efficiently during through-hole and blind-hole operations.

Key Features

  • M42 cobalt alloy construction maintains hardness at elevated cutting temperatures
  • 135-degree split point reduces thrust and eliminates walking without a center punch
  • Gold oxide coating improves lubricity and extends tool life in hard materials
  • Web-thinned, tapered web configuration reduces cutting resistance
  • Meets DIN 338 and NAS 907 Type J standards for heavy-duty drilling
  • Regular spiral, right-hand flute geometry for efficient chip evacuation

Compatibility

Designed for use in any standard drill chuck accepting a 0.0860-inch straight cylindrical shank. Optimized for drilling titanium and similarly hard or work-hardening metals; suitable for other ferrous and non-ferrous materials requiring a heavy-duty cobalt bit in the No. 44 wire size range.

Installation Notes

This bit is intended for use by machinists and trade professionals operating drill presses, hand drills, or CNC equipment. Secure the shank fully in the chuck and verify runout before cutting. Use appropriate cutting fluid when drilling titanium or other hard alloys to extend tool life and maintain dimensional tolerance. Inspect the cutting edges before each use and replace the bit if chipping or wear is observed.
